The Ehwa flower (오얏꽃 or Ouyat - plum blossom) once represented the Korean Empire. It was used on palace decorations and currency during the latter period of the Joseon Dynasty. It was then designated as the official crest of the royal palace after the foundation of the Korean Empire. The emblem is a simple design with five petals symmetrically placed around the center..

Remove heavy tarnish with warm water, mild soap and a clean, soft cotton or flannel cloth, a special sterling silver cleaning cloth or a very soft-bristle brush like a baby toothbrush.
Silver polish or dip-style cleaning solutions are NOT recommended.
When not in use, please store the design in the provided pouch with the anti-tarnish tab.
